The Importance of Oral Health
Oral health is more than just having a nice smile. It plays a crucial role in your overall well-being. Poor oral hygiene can lead to gum disease, tooth decay, and even more severe health issues like heart disease and diabetes. A healthy mouth is a gateway to a healthy body, making it essential to understand and implement proper oral care routines.
Understanding Oral Hygiene
Good oral hygiene involves more than just brushing your teeth. Here are several key components:
Brushing Techniques:
- Use a soft-bristled toothbrush.
- Brush for at least two minutes, covering all surfaces.
- Replace your toothbrush every three to four months.
Flossing:
- Floss daily to remove food particles and plaque between teeth.
- Use a gentle sawing motion to avoid damaging gums.
Mouthwash:
- Choose an antibacterial mouthwash to reduce plaque.
- Rinse daily to maintain fresh breath and eliminate germs.

Diet and Oral Health
What you eat significantly impacts your oral health. A balanced diet promotes strong teeth and gums.
Foods to Include
Calcium-Rich Foods:
- Milk, cheese, and yogurt strengthen tooth enamel.
- Leafy greens and almonds are also excellent sources of calcium.
Crunchy Fruits and Vegetables:
- Apples, carrots, and celery help clean teeth naturally.
- These foods also stimulate saliva production, which neutralizes acids in the mouth.
Water:
- Drinking water throughout the day helps wash away food particles and bacteria.
- Fluoridated water can further protect against tooth decay.
Foods to Avoid
Sugary Snacks and Beverages:
- Sugar promotes the growth of harmful bacteria that cause cavities.
- Limit intake of candies, sodas, and other sugary treats.
Acidic Foods and Drinks:
- Citrus fruits, wine, and soda can erode tooth enamel over time.
- Rinse your mouth with water after consuming these items to minimize damage.
The Role of Fluoride
Fluoride is a mineral that helps prevent tooth decay by making teeth more resistant to acid attacks from plaque bacteria and sugars in the mouth.
Sources of Fluoride
- Toothpaste:
- Use fluoride toothpaste to help strengthen enamel.
- Brush at least twice a day for optimal results.
- Tap Water:
- Many communities, including Honolulu, add fluoride to their drinking water.
- Drinking tap water is an easy way to get a daily dose of fluoride.
- Mouth Rinses:
- Consider using a fluoride mouth rinse for additional protection.
- Follow the instructions on the label to achieve the best results.
Protecting Your Teeth
Taking extra steps to protect your teeth can prevent damage and maintain oral health.
Tips for Protection
Wear a Mouthguard:
- Use a mouthguard during sports to prevent injuries.
- Custom-fitted mouthguards offer the best protection.
Avoid Using Teeth as Tools:
- Don’t use your teeth to open packages or bottles.
- Using teeth improperly can lead to chips and cracks.
Limit Snacking:
- Frequent snacking increases the risk of cavities.
- Stick to regular meals and healthy snacks.
